Jadestone Energy plc, Singapore, has again shut in oil production at Montara field in the Timor Sea offshore northern Australia following an incident on the Montara Venture floating production, storage, and offtake vessel (FPSO).

A gas alarm was triggered within ballast water tank 4S on July 29, indicating possible communication with one of the adjacent tanks within the FPSO, the company said in a release.

Key stakeholders, including the National Offshore Petroleum Safety and Environmental Management Authority (NOPSEMA), were notified. The tank will be emptied and cleaned over the next week to permit inspection to identify the source of the communication between tanks and allow for appropriate repairs.

Paul Blakeley, president and chief executive officer, said the shut-in was disappointing and frustrating, but that the company would find and repair any additional defect while continuing with the overall planned program of inspection of the storage tanks.

Production had resumed in March following a 7-month shut-in due to oil leaks and related problems on the FPSO (OGJ Online, Mar. 24, 2023).
